.maps-modal[data-astro-cid-7vipeoyc]{display:grid}@media (max-width: 1023px){.maps-modal[data-astro-cid-7vipeoyc]{grid-template-rows:auto auto}}@media (min-width: 1024px){.maps-modal[data-astro-cid-7vipeoyc]{grid-template-columns:auto 24rem}}.dialog-scroller:has(.maps-modal){border-radius:var(--dimension__rounded-corner);padding:0!important}@media (min-width: 640px){.dialog-scroller:has(.maps-modal){max-height:85vh;max-width:85vw}}.maps-modal__map[data-astro-cid-7vipeoyc],.maps-modal__details[data-astro-cid-7vipeoyc]{padding:1.875rem;display:flex;flex-direction:column;gap:1.875rem}.maps-modal__map[data-astro-cid-7vipeoyc]{background-color:rgb(var(--color__cloud--light))}@media (min-width: 1024px){.maps-modal__map[data-astro-cid-7vipeoyc]{grid-column:1}.maps-modal__details[data-astro-cid-7vipeoyc]{padding-right:1rem}}.maps-modal__iframe-wrapper[data-astro-cid-7vipeoyc]{min-height:33vh;flex-grow:1;background-color:rgb(var(--color__cloud));border-radius:var(--dimension__rounded-corner)}.maps-modal__iframe[data-astro-cid-7vipeoyc]{width:100%;height:100%;border:0;border-radius:var(--dimension__rounded-corner)}.maps-modal__title[data-astro-cid-7vipeoyc]{margin:0;font-size:1.125rem;color:rgb(var(--color__navy))}.maps-modal__photo[data-astro-cid-7vipeoyc]{width:25rem;max-width:100%;object-fit:cover;object-position:50% 50%;align-self:start;border-radius:var(--dimension__rounded-corner)}@media (min-width: 640px) and (max-width: 1023px){.maps-modal__photo[data-astro-cid-7vipeoyc]{flex-shrink:1}}@media (min-width: 640px) and (max-width: 1023px){.maps-modal__details[data-astro-cid-7vipeoyc]{flex-direction:row}}@media (min-width: 1024px){.maps-modal__details{grid-column:2}}.maps-modal__details-title[data-astro-cid-7vipeoyc]{margin:0!important;font-size:1.125rem;color:rgb(var(--color__charcoal))}.maps-modal__details-list[data-astro-cid-7vipeoyc]{display:flex;flex-direction:column;gap:1rem 2rem}@media (min-width: 640px) and (max-width: 1023px){.maps-modal__details-list[data-astro-cid-7vipeoyc]{flex-shrink:0}}.maps-modal__detail[data-astro-cid-7vipeoyc]{display:grid;grid-template-columns:1.875rem auto;gap:.75rem}@media (max-width: 1023px){.maps-modal__detail[data-astro-cid-7vipeoyc]{font-size:.875rem}}.maps-modal__detail[data-astro-cid-7vipeoyc] ul,.maps-modal__detail[data-astro-cid-7vipeoyc] ol{margin:1rem 0 0;padding:0 0 0 1.125rem;list-style-type:disc}.maps-modal__detail[data-astro-cid-7vipeoyc] .icon{margin:0 -.1875rem;width:1.875rem;height:1.875rem}.maps-modal__detail[data-astro-cid-7vipeoyc] a[data-astro-cid-7vipeoyc],.maps-modal__detail[data-astro-cid-7vipeoyc] a[data-astro-cid-7vipeoyc]:link,.maps-modal__detail[data-astro-cid-7vipeoyc] a[data-astro-cid-7vipeoyc]:visited,.maps-modal__detail[data-astro-cid-7vipeoyc] a[data-astro-cid-7vipeoyc]:hover,.maps-modal__detail[data-astro-cid-7vipeoyc] a[data-astro-cid-7vipeoyc]:active{color:var(--color__charcoal)!important;font-weight:initial!important;text-decoration:underline}.contact-us__heading[data-astro-cid-5c24fmmt]{margin-bottom:1.5rem}.contact_us__intro-text[data-astro-cid-5c24fmmt]{margin-bottom:3rem}.contact-us__contact_numbers[data-astro-cid-5c24fmmt]{background-color:rgb(var(--color__cloud--light));border-radius:var(--dimension__rounded-corner);text-align:center;padding:2rem 0;margin:6rem 0}@media (min-width: 640px) and (max-width: 960px){.contact-us__contact_numbers .container--columns[style],.contact-us__offices .container--columns[style]{--container-columns-actual: 3}}.contact-us__contact_number[data-astro-cid-5c24fmmt]{padding-top:1rem;padding-bottom:1rem;text-align:center}.contact-us__contact_number[data-astro-cid-5c24fmmt] h3[data-astro-cid-5c24fmmt]{margin:0}@media (min-width: 640px){.contact-us__contact_number[data-astro-cid-5c24fmmt]:not(:last-child){border-right:1px solid rgb(var(--color__extra-gray))}}@media (max-width: 640px){.contact-us__contact_numbers[data-astro-cid-5c24fmmt]{padding:1.5rem}.contact-us__contact_number[data-astro-cid-5c24fmmt]{padding-top:0;padding-bottom:0}.contact-us__contact_number[data-astro-cid-5c24fmmt]:not(:last-child){border-bottom:1px solid rgb(var(--color__extra-gray));padding-bottom:1.5rem}}@media (max-width: 768px){.contact-us__contact_number[data-astro-cid-5c24fmmt] h3[data-astro-cid-5c24fmmt]{font-size:1.2rem}}.contact-us__contact_number_number[data-astro-cid-5c24fmmt]{margin-top:1rem}.contact-us__contact_number_number[data-astro-cid-5c24fmmt] a[data-astro-cid-5c24fmmt]{font-weight:400;text-decoration:none;color:rgb(var(--color__gray--dark))}.contact-us__contact_number_number[data-astro-cid-5c24fmmt] a[data-astro-cid-5c24fmmt]:hover{text-decoration:underline;color:inherit}.contact-us__offices_region[data-astro-cid-5c24fmmt] h3[data-astro-cid-5c24fmmt]{margin-bottom:1rem}.contact-us__offices_region[data-astro-cid-5c24fmmt]:not(:last-child){border-bottom:1px solid rgb(var(--color__extra-gray));padding-bottom:4rem;margin-bottom:4rem}.contact-us__offices_office[data-astro-cid-5c24fmmt]{display:flex;flex-direction:column;gap:1rem}.contact-us__offices_office_numbers[data-astro-cid-5c24fmmt] p[data-astro-cid-5c24fmmt]{margin:0}.contact-us__email__thank-you__text[data-astro-cid-5c24fmmt],.contact-us__get-updates__thank-you__text[data-astro-cid-5c24fmmt]{margin-bottom:3rem}.contact-us__get-updates__info[data-astro-cid-5c24fmmt] ul[data-astro-cid-5c24fmmt]{margin-top:1.5rem;list-style-type:disc;padding-left:2rem}.contact-us__get-updates__info[data-astro-cid-5c24fmmt] ul[data-astro-cid-5c24fmmt] li[data-astro-cid-5c24fmmt]{margin-bottom:1.5rem}.contact-us__get-updates__form[data-astro-cid-5c24fmmt]{background-color:rgb(var(--color__cloud--light));border-radius:var(--dimension__rounded-corner);padding:3rem 2rem}.contact-us__get-updates__thank-you[data-astro-cid-5c24fmmt]{display:none}.contact-us__email-form.prefilled #formContactUsType{font-weight:500!important}
